是什么令 Python 成为伟大的开发语言?

原文: PyCoder's Weekly - Issue #399


  • 191211 Zoom.Quiet(大妈) 用时 42 分钟 完成快译
  • 191211 Zoom.Quiet(大妈) 用时 17 分钟 完成格式转抄.

"What makes Python a great language? It gets the need to know balance right. [... ] I would argue that the Python language has an incredibly well-balanced sense of what developers need to know. Better than any other language I've used."



人家老爹从没说过类似的... Linus 倒是经常嗯哼...


Python 对各种开发者都有友好的切入点, 而且有统一的成品代码观感.


In this step-by-step tutorial, you'll learn the fundamentals of descriptive statistics and how to calculate them in Python. You'll find out how to describe, summarize, and represent your data visually using NumPy, SciPy, Pandas, Matplotlib, and the built-in Python statistics library.




"Learning about these anti-patterns will help you to avoid them in your own code and make you a better programmer (hopefully). Each pattern comes with a small description, examples and possible solutions."


每年都有人用 Py 将设计模式,反转一下


Whether you're documenting a small script or a large project, whether you're a beginner or seasoned Pythonista, this video series will cover everything you need to know.



docstrings ... 不配合 CI/CD 实时变成可自动发布的文档网络, 没人 care 写什么的...


Congratulations! Related discussion on Hacker News.


叕一个运行时包依赖管理工具, 而且是要求显式声明的...每次使用时,,.,,


Tips and best practices for exploring SQL databases with Pandas and SQLAlchemy.




可惜 py2 语法不兼容. )


因为几乎所有流行框架中, 都依赖这货




最后3秒, Python 疯狂反转一切.



Articles, Tutorials and Talks

This tutorial will prepare you for some common questions you'll encounter during your data engineer interview. You'll learn how to answer questions about databases, ETL pipelines, and big data workflows. You'll also take a look at SQL, NoSQL, and Redis use cases and query examples.



真蟒的面试经, 系列... )

"This would likely going to be found totally irrelevant by 99.999% of Python programmers. If you are not the type of person who is annoyed by tiny oddities, you probably do not want to read any further."


叕一篇发布在 blogger.com 上的文章, 这家被 google 收购的 blog 平台, 已经很多年没升级系统了, 但是, 并不影响大家忠诚使用...毕竟好用,

所以, 被和谐了.所以, 下载共享给大家:

Only Python_ A Tiny Python Exception Oddity.pdf


"I've been hacking on this new [Python] DSL for design that allows the designer to specify figures in terms of relationships, which are compiled down to constraints and solved using an SMT solver."




How to reduce memory usage via smaller dtypes and sparse arrays, and what to do in situations where these solutions won't work.


嗯哼? 上周是有损压缩呢...


A quick tutorial on documenting your Python project with the Sphinx documentation generator and tox for build automation.


世界已经是 md 的了, rST 还是...


How CPython implements and uses symbol tables in its quest to compile Python source code into bytecode.

Thoughts about how API schemas could be used for property-based testing.


虽然好,但是, 都是无望进入 build-in 行列的好东西哪... )


知道大家忙, 还帮倒忙?

当然, 这是 mypy 的梗,为了性能, 一切都能忍



每年都有人将设计模式用 Py 来嗯哼一次...



Python 教育? 已经被中国人玩出花了...



Interesting Projects, Tools and Libraries, Projects & Code








📆🐍 活动/大会

Events, MeetUp 真的是全球线下活动组织中心


❤️ Happy Pythonic ;-(大妈私人无责任播报)

(( ̄▽ ̄):

第4期已开始, 为期6周;

当前 ch2
200112 按时结束


200203 可以上线



NN 3865


大妈的多重宇宙 - YouTube

点击注册~> 获得 100$ 体验券: DigitalOcean Referral Badge

订阅 substack 体验古早写作:
Zoom.Quiet’s Chaos42 | Substack

关注公众号, 持续获得相关各种嗯哼:


**2021.01.11** 因大妈再次创业暂停定期开设, 转换为预约触发:
  • + 任何问题, 随时邮件提问可也: